'Rival my $200 pair': Shoppers lose it over $25 Kmart jeans

A pair of bargain $25 Kmart jeans are going viral online with shoppers claiming they rival more expensive brands.

One woman shared a photo of her sporting the Sculpting Skinny Jeans and it’s prompted plenty of other customers to share their love for the denim.

“For $25, these jeans rival my $200+ jeans,” Abbey wrote, alongside images of her wearing the Extra High Rise Ankle Length version.

“They're super sculpting, high waisted and tight fitting. Feel really good on! I got the last pair at my local Kmart.”

“I've been living in leggings over iso period, so it's nice to actually wear a pair of jeans that feel like I'm wearing leggings,” she added in the comments.

The praises kept on rolling in with plenty of other women commenting and sharing their own photos of their ‘amazing’ pair.

“I also have these jeans and honestly you are spot on they are amazing,” one person wrote.

“I love my black high rise skinny jeans. So good for my mum tummy,” another added.

“I grabbed a pair the other day and was really impressed when I tried them on. I’m a 14 and found the same, no cutting in but sitting firmly. Also huge bonus, not having to pull them up all day long,” was another rave review.

While a fourth simply said: “Hands down the best jeans.”

Speaking of iso fashion, Kmart’s $30 tracksuit set had already made waves online as the perfect work from home loungewear.

The Textured Drop Shoulder Top and Wide Leg Pants retail for just $15 a piece, $30 for the set, and have proven to be a smash hit among fans with some even dubbing it their new ‘essential uniform’.

“These are the most comfy track pants I own,” one said.

“Wow I need these for iso [isolation] life,” another agreed.
